Job Description

Duties

As a PHYSICAL SCIENTIST at the GS-1301-14 some of your typical work assignments may include:
  • Serves as a subject matter expert for all aspects and phases of Science and Technology related to the development of software applications spanning basic research (BA1) through prototype development (BA3).
  • Provides an advanced understanding of artificial intelligence, machine learning algorithms, and data fusion techniques required to automate battlespace data collection and reduce cognitive burden to provide actionable intelligence to ensure the warfighter can prepare for, operate, and sustain missions within chemical and biological (CB) contested environments.
  • Identifies and translates customer requirements into technical objectives, provides and evaluates alternatives for achieving objectives, prepares technical and fiscal program plans.
  • Provides expertise to the RD-CBEI Information Sciences Branch Chief and the RD-CBE Division Director in the area of physical sciences to include concepts, principles, and practices of physical chemistry, physics, or related environmental sciences as they apply to chemical and biological threat agents.
  • Interprets and translates end user requirements into technical specifications that can be used to solicit science and technology research.

Qualifications

You may qualify at the GS 14 , if you fulfill the following qualifications:

A. One year of specialized experience equivalent to the 13 grade level in the Federal service, military, or private sector:
  • Applying advance AI (Artificial Intelligence) and data fusion methodologies to automate battle-space data collection, reduce war-fighter cognitive burden, and deliver actionable intelligence for mission preparation and sustainment in Chemical and Biological (CB) contested environments
  • Developing technical objectives, providing, and evaluating alternatives for achieving objectives, preparing technical and fiscal program plans
  • Interpreting and translating end user requirements into technical specifications that can be used for soliciting science and technology research
Experience refers to paid and unpaid experience, including volunteer work done through National Service programs (e.g., Peace Corps, AmeriCorps) and other organizations (e.g., professional; philanthropic; religious; spiritual; community, student, social). Volunteer work helps build critical competencies, knowledge, and skills and can provide valuable training and experience that translates directly to paid employment. You will receive credit for all qualifying experience, including volunteer experience.

In addition to meeting qualifications, your application package must reflect the applicable experience to meet the Individual Occupational Requirements for the 1301, series as listed below:

A. Degree: physical science, engineering, or mathematics that included 24 semester hours in physical science and/or related engineering science such as mechanics, dynamics, properties of materials, and electronics.
Or
B. Combination of education and experience -- education equivalent to one of the majors shown in A above that included at least 24 semester hours in physical science and/or related engineering science, plus appropriate experience or additional education.
